Ar-Ram: 3 detaineesinfo-icon at the checkpoint
(for having bypassed through an alternative route), released very
soon after we inquired. We checked the alternative route opposite
the old Sunny 2000. Quite a few Palestinians were marching towards
Jerusalem.

Qalandya North: A long pedestrian queue, as well as of cars. CP
commander O. immediately asked us to step back, in order not to
"disturb" their work. He claimed that our presence always
causes a disturbance among the Palestinians. Palestinians who were
not equipped with the appropriate documents were all sent back, but
a basketball team on their way to play a game in Ramallah passed,
after the captain deposited a list of the players at the
checkpoint. We met a young man near Atarot, who had been arrested 2
weeks ago, following the shooting incident. We were invited by his
family, and listened to his story: 6 days confinement in Beit El
followed by another 6 days in Ofer Camp. He claims to have no idea
why he was arrested - the army did not even interrogate him. But he
counted his blessings: 12 days are a "short" confinement.
He was released at night time, as is the norm (and against the
law).
